A passenger on board a cruise-to-nowhere from Singapore has tested positive for Covid-19, the operator Royal Caribbean said on Wednesday.
Singapore has been trialling the trips which are open only to the city-states residents, make no stops and sail in waters close by. At 2.45 am on Wednesday morning, the captain…
